Whatever a student does in school will affect what's happening in the students personal life. Whatever is happening in a students personal life, will inevitably affect what happens in a student's academic life. It's all a matter of appropriate balance. The student needs time to be in class, time for study, time for other responsibilities, time for family, time for a social life, and some time to just be alone. This takes good time-management skills that students must develop to be successful.
